Recap: Burroughs vs. Glendale

Burroughs won the last time they faced Glendale, and things went their way on Thursday, too. Burroughs put a hurting on Glendale to the tune of 45-6. The victory was a breath of fresh air for Burroughs as it put an end to their four-game losing streak.

The game started off well for Burroughs, whose offense put up 21 first-half points. Meanwhile, Glendale couldn't get anything going offensively, leaving the score at 21-0 heading into the break. The Burroughs defense stood its ground in the third quarter, giving up 6 and all but finishing the matchup.

No one put up better numbers for Burroughs than sophomore Luke Rogers, who brought his A game into the match. He rushed for 208 yards and 2 touchdowns. Junior Nicholas Garcia was in the mix, too, providing Burroughs with 2 touchdowns. The win bumped their record up to 1-4. The defeat dropped Glendale's record to 1-4.
